We run a successful boarding facility so we are fully aware of all the different needs and health conditions that come with many horses. So we turned to using slow feed nets for the reasons I have listed below
respiratory issues from burrowing heads into bales( can’t do that with a net)
aggressive behaviours around hay ( too busy pulling hay for that now)
Over weight horses not letting under weight ones eat( too busy for that now net keeps them busy)
over weight horses eating too much ( net keeps that under control as it mimics grazing)
horses with colic issues or ulcer issues( net is like grazing which is what their systems are designed for, horses are healthier eating from nets)
